Seven temperature and salinity profiles from Sermilik Fjord in Southeast Greenland. The profiles were collected using Sippican XCTD-1 eXpendable Conductivity Temperature Depth (XCTD) probes hand deployed from a helicopter (Profile #2 - 7). One profile was hand deployed from the M/V Adolf Jensen (Profile #1). The profiles were collected on July 31 and August 6 2019 in the plume, ice mélange, and main fjord branch regions of the Helheim Glacier and Sermilik Fjord system. The profiles were manually examined, quality controlled, and are provided as 2-meter (m) depth bin averaged profiles. The collection of these XCTD profiles was done concurrently with a shipboard survey of Sermilik Fjord from July 26 to August 1 2019. The shipboard CTD data are provided separately. These data were collected as part of a long-term project to monitor Sermilik Fjord to determine what water masses flow into and out of the fjord; in particular, if warm, Atlantic water from the Irminger Sea penetrates into the fjord and how freshwater from ice melt is diluted and transported out of the fjord. Observations have been collected in the fjord since 2008.
